## Runbook: Petalgraph N+1 mitigation

If query latency spikes on the Petalgraph API, the batched loader may have fallen back to per-row fetches, reintroducing the N+1 pattern. Confirm via the resolver metrics dashboard, then restart the loader pool. Do not scale the database first; it masks the issue. After restart, verify the service picked up the configuration values shown below.

deployment values, kajep-kageg:
[praix]
host = praix.paliqcorp.corp
user = praix_svc
database = praix_prod

On-call: Thursday 01:00 we fail over the Quillbank idempotency-key store to the Marrowfield replica. During the window, payment retries may see elevated key-lookup latency; duplicates should still be rejected, so page me if you see a double charge in the shadow ledger. Checklist: snapshot the key table, flip the resolver flag, run the replay harness, confirm dedupe rate stays above 99.9%. The cold-standby vault requires manual unsealing; its recovery passphrase appears on the line below.

unlock words, fawif-hahip: eliax-ulador-holdor-novix-prawyn-norius-kelax-weniel-alddor-ulaion

Capacity note for the Rynholt gateway reconnect bug: clients caught in the retry loop hammer the handshake endpoint, roughly tripling auth-path load during incidents. From a security angle, this also amplifies token-validation traffic. We capped reconnect storms with jittered backoff and a per-client ceiling. Review the enforced limits below.

tuning constants:
BUDGETS = {
    "druath": 240,
    "lamwyn": 180,
    "silael": 275,
}

**Q: Does Framekit strip EXIF metadata from uploaded images?**

Yes. All images passing through the Framekit ingest pipeline have EXIF data scrubbed by default, including GPS coordinates, device serials, and timestamps. Plugin authors should not rely on EXIF fields being present downstream. If your plugin legitimately needs orientation data, request it via the normalized metadata API instead, which preserves rotation as a sanitized field. The full list of scrubbed and preserved fields is maintained on our reference page.

operations page: https://jenkins.zemvarcloud.local/job/merge_requests/repo/build/73930b4b30f0a8ed